Looking back in the year of 2016, we are very proud.This year, APQN entered its 13-year-old blooming age,showing its vibrant, vigorous tendency of sustainable development.
In this very year, APQN successfully completed the new election at expiration of the last office term. It ensured the ship of APQN to continue its voyage march on to the “blue sea” of education quality without border under the direction made by the previous 4 Boards as well as under the leadership of the new Board.
In this very year, APQN completed “Dissolving Boundaries for a Quality Region:APQN Strategic Plan (2016-2019)”, in which APQN strengthen the goal, the mission, the vision and the value made by the previous 4 Boards. It ensured APQN’s first step to complete the seven goals and actions along with ten targets in the next three years.
In this very year, APQN launched the project of “the Compilation of APQN Procedure Manual” pursuant to APQN Constitution, which added more chapters such as “volunteer”, “fund-raising project”, “publication” and other chapters on the original version. It ensured APQN’s ability to function systematically and sustainably.
In this very year, APQN, together with National Assessment and Accreditation Council (NAAC) in India, released “Bengaluru Statement 2016 on Next-Generation Quality Assurance of Higher Education: A shared vision and commitment for fostering partnership beyond borders”. It ensured that APQN would join hands with the colleagues from Asia, Europe, America and Africa to establish a global quality platform.
In this very year, APQN held 2016 APQN Annual Conference (AAC) and Annual General Meeting(AGM) hosted by Fiji Higher Education Commission in May in Fiji, co-organizedGlobal Summit on Quality Higher Education in September in India, held the International Conference on Quality Assurance co-operated with Macao Institute College in November in China and held the Workshop of APQN’s and APQR’s Membershipswith Indonesian Accreditation Agency for Higher Education in Health (IAAHEH) in Jakarta……
